#fb4d3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fb4d3e is composed of 98.4% red, 30.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 4.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#fb4d3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a7c with #f70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fb4d3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fb4d3e has RGB values of R:251, G:77,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.75,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16469310.

Shades and Tints of #fb4d3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120200 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b4d3e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09999 is the less saturated color, while #fb4d3e is the most saturated one.
